Method
Preparation of Chicken
- 1
Marinate Chicken
In a bowl, combine the chicken breasts with olive oil, salt, and black pepper. Ensure the chicken is evenly coated. Allow it to marinate for at least 30 minutes.
- 2
Cooking Fettuccine
- 3
Boil Water
In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Use about 1 tablespoon of salt for every 4 quarts of water.
- 4
Cook Pasta
Once the water is boiling, add the fettuccine pasta and cook according to package instructions, typically about 10-12 minutes, until al dente. Drain the pasta and set aside.
Making Alfredo Sauce
- 5
- 6
Add Cream and Cheese
Pour in the he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er. Gradually whisk in the grated Parmesan and shredded mozzarella cheese until melted and smooth. Add a pinch of nutmeg for flavor.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Combine and Serve
- 7
Mix Pasta and Sauce
In a large mixing bowl, combine the drained fettuccine with the Alfredo sauce. Toss until the pasta is well coated.
- 8
Serve
Slice the grilled chicken and place it on top of the fettuccine Alfredo.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ot.
